A timeless climbing rose with full, pure-white blooms that open in old-fashioned, reflexed form—each flower carries 50–60 petals and a strong, sweet fragrance. With a graceful, arching habit and repeat flushes through the season, White Cap is as rewarding in a trellis as it is when grown as a large shrub.
-
Mature Size: Up to 10 ft tall
-
Bloom & Form: Very full (41+ petals), cluster‑flowered, in small clusters
-
Garden Use: Ideal for climbing over walls, pillars, or pergolas; also thrives as a free‑standing shrub
-
Special Notes: Bred by the Brownell family in 1954; praised for its vigor, cold hardiness, and refined charm
